High Season vs. Low Season

Rio De Janeiro Carnival

The high season in Rio de Janeiro runs from December to March, coinciding with the summer holidays in Brazil and other countries worldwide. This period can be the best time to visit Rio de Janeiro if you want to experience the city's vibrant energy and enjoy its beaches, nightlife, and famous Carnival celebration. However, Rio de Janeiro is incredibly crowded during this period, and prices for accommodations, tours, and attractions are usually higher than during other times of the year.

The low season in Rio de Janeiro runs from June to September, coinciding with the winter months in Brazil. Although it's not the best time to visit Rio de Janeiro if you're looking for beach weather, the city is less crowded during this period, and prices for accommodations and other activities are lower. Additionally, the winter months are an excellent time to experience cultural events and festivals such as the Festa Junina and the Brazilian Independence Day.

Weather Conditions

Rio De Janeiro Weather

Rio de Janeiro has a tropical climate with temperatures ranging between 75°F - 82°F (24°C - 28°C) throughout the year. However, the rainy season in Rio de Janeiro runs from December to April, which can be a damper on your beach vacation plans. The best time to visit Rio de Janeiro for beach weather is from May to September when the skies are clear, and the temperatures are cooler. It's important to keep in mind that, despite the dry weather, the water in Rio de Janeiro can be quite cold during these months, so make sure to pack accordingly.

Events and Festivals

Rio De Janeiro Samba

Rio de Janeiro is famous for its Carnival celebration, one of the most vibrant and colorful events in the world. Carnival takes place in February or March, depending on the date of Easter, and it's the best time to visit Rio de Janeiro if you want to experience the city's party atmosphere at its peak. However, if you're not a fan of crowds and noise, it's best to avoid Carnival since the city is incredibly busy during this period.

Other events and festivals worth mentioning are the Festa Junina, which takes place in June and celebrates the Brazilian countryside's culture, and the Brazilian Independence Day, which takes place in September and features patriotic parades and celebrations throughout the city.
